elephant herd in Keonjhar

A massive elephant herd in Keonjhar district of Odisha created a traffic jam on National Highway.  Vehicular movement disrupted after elephant herd remained on NH-20 for a long time.

This scene was witnessed near Dalita on Rimuli-Champua National Highway 20 in Keonjhar district. A herd of 25 elephants stood on the road for a long time while crossing the national highway. As the elephants did not move away from the road, the vehicular movement was disrupted on both sides of the road.

On receiving information, forest department officials reached the spot and alerted people. After a long time, the elephant herd crossed the road and entered the forest, and vehicular movement became normal.

According to the information, the elephant herd was crossing the national highway to move from the forest area to the other side. However, since the elephants remained in the middle of the road for a long time, vehicular movement stopped on both sides.

A large number of vehicles had stopped on both sides of the road. After a long time, the elephant herd crossed the road and entered the forest again. After this, the traffic on the national highway returned to normal. The eyewitnesses on the NH were in a state of shock and excitement.
